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1886169 2920795 2766649
1568063099 51446
1568063099 51446
962094 9704 94 64 71038651475
All about undefined
Interested in learning more?
1568063099 51446
962094 9704 94 64 71038651475
See more
4625887 59 9484525
95916 5538 5353534519
See more
997641 322724920
73 2067083 44226 3933
See more